Enlightenment is a traditionally mystical and slippery concept, but when it is subjected to the rigors of empirical analysis, there is a lot to be learned about our brains and ourselves. ❍ Subscribe to The Well on YouTube: https://bit.ly/welcometothewell ❍ Up next: How to live an intellectual life https://youtu.be/3BnzdsjpypY Dr. Andrew Newberg says that there are two kinds of enlightenment: enlightenment with a "lowercase e," which changes our opinions about the world, and Enlightenment with a "capital E," which changes our essence — that is, how we think about life, death, and God. Capital-E Enlightenment is notable because of how people report the experience anecdotally, as well as how it changes the brain. If there is a sensation associated with this type of Enlightenment — such as seeing a light or color or hearing a sound — it is described as one of the most intense experiences that a person has ever had. And this intensity is reflected in the brain’s limbic system, which processes emotion, and in its parietal lobe, which organizes our sensory information to create sensations of time, space, and self. When people experience Enlightenment, they frequently report losing their sense of self, and scientific analysis confirms that brain activity is driving this sensation. Though Enlightenment is typically associated with fervently religious or spiritual individuals like Mother Teresa or the Buddha, people from all walks of life can experience essence-changing events — sometimes just walking down the street, Dr. Newberg tells us. Similar experiences can be purposefully induced through the use of pharmacological substances like LSD or hallucinogenic mushrooms. Philosophically, what does Enlightenment mean? According to Dr. Newberg, perhaps Enlightenment is like a pair of glasses: We are born into the world with bad vision until we experience corrective lenses. In this case, the "lenses" are being applied to our brain rather than our eyes. Experimental neuroscientist Patrick McNamara on how we can harness spiritual experience to explore alternate realities in our minds, and transform our models of the self. ❍ Subscribe to The Well on YouTube: https://bit.ly/welcometothewell ❍ Up next: How enlightenment permanently alters your brain https://youtu.be/3PIQj7Fxk30 Patrick McNamara, an experimental neuroscientist, argues that the function of religion is not just to quell existential anxiety or stave off the fear of death, but to disrupt current models of the self, and update those models in relation to the world around us. Religious experiences promote imaginative simulation of other possible worlds, giving us space to update those models respective of our circumstances. One core facet of the spiritual experience is what McNamara calls ‘de-centering’ — a powerful neurotechnology that promotes self-transformation, but which makes us incredibly vulnerable when triggered. When held in the context of a ritual, like many religious practices promote, we can achieve massive growth and transcendence. But de-centering isn’t just safe within the context of religion: non-religious people can re-discover or create their own rich traditions to support the de-centering experience. The field of experimental neuroscience is uncovering some fundamental aspects of human nature and human experience, simultaneously enhancing our understanding of this realm but also deepening the mystery. McNamara's research sheds light on the potential benefits of religion and ritual, and highlights how much more is still to be learned about how these processes can be harnessed for positive transformation. Subscribe to The Well on YouTube ► https://bit.ly/thewell-youtube Watch Lisa Feldman Barrett’s next interview ► https://youtu.be/0QfCvIJRtE0 Our perception of reality is not an exact representation of the objective truth but rather a combination of sensory inputs and the brain’s interpretation of these signals. This interpretation is influenced by past experiences and is often predictive, with the brain creating categories of similar instances to anticipate future events. The brain’s categorization process extends beyond physical characteristics to include abstract, functional features. This ability allows humans to create “social reality,” where we collectively assign functions or meanings to objects or concepts that don’t inherently possess them, such as the value of money or the concept of borders and citizenship. The brain’s capacity for imagination, drawing from past experiences to create something entirely new, is a double-edged sword. But this has led to some common myths about emotions, and neuroscientist Lisa Feldman Barrett wants to debunk them. Barrett argues that emotions are not hardwired into the brain from birth, but rather stem from events that the brain creates based on past experiences and predictions of what's going to happen. Contrary to popular understanding, emotions are not just reactive events that happen to us — we play an active role in creating them. By learning new things, watching movies, or even acting in a play to get outside of the normal range of what the brain predicts, Barrett argues that it’s possible to change those predictive patterns, and by doing so, to become the architects of our future selves. Understanding how our brain creates emotions can help us manage them — freeing us from repeated patterns of behavior and empowering us to control our emotions and heal ourselves. How to stay calm when you know you'll be stressed | Daniel Levitin | TED
Visit http://TED.com to get our entire library of TED Talks, transcripts, translations, personalized talk recommendations and more. You're not at your best when you're stressed. In fact, your brain has evolved over millennia to release cortisol in stressful situations, inhibiting rational, logical thinking but potentially helping you survive, say, being attacked by a lion. Neuroscientist Daniel Levitin thinks there's a way to avoid making critical mistakes in stressful situations, when your thinking becomes clouded — the pre-mortem. "We all are going to fail now and then," he says. "The idea is to think ahead to what those failures might be." Two giants of science and technology—Nobel Laureate in physics, Sir Roger Penrose, and inventor of the microprocessor, Federico Faggin—meet to discuss their ideas on the relationship between Quantum Physics and consciousness, with the special participation of our own Bernardo Kastrup. While always respectful and congenial, the participants don't shy away from disagreements. Their starting difference regards Quantum Theory itself: while Federico Faggin and Bernardo Kastrup allow its implications to inform their views, Sir Roger Penrose believes the theory itself to be at least incomplete and require further development. The discussion helps pin down and make explicit the fine points of the three gentlemen's respective ideas regarding consciousness.
